Some parameters of Sophos Anti-Virus Admins, such as users and groups, can be centrally created and managed by the local admin. When Sophos groups and users are centrally managed in a network, it may be more convenient to install and uninstall Sophos Anti-Virus for Linux using special options to omit user and group parameters from the install and uninstall commands, as shown below.
Installation options
--no-add-user
Assume that the sophosav user already exists, and therefore do not create the user.
--no-add-group
Assume that the sophosav group already exists, and therefore do not create the group.
Uninstallation options
--no-remove-user
Do not attempt to remove the sophosav user on uninstallation.
--no-remove-group
Do not attempt to remove the sophosav group on uninstallation.
